×
Windows Server 2022 Üzerine Hyper-V Kurulumu

Windows Server 2022 Üzerine Hyper-V Kurulumu

Windows Server 2022, kurum içi sanallaştırma altyapıları için son derece kararlı, güvenli ve yüksek performanslı bir platform sunar. Microsoft’un kurumsal sanallaştırma rolü olan Hyper-V, fiziksel kaynakları izole ederek sanal makineler halinde sunmayı sağlar. Bu yazımda, fiziksel bir Windows Server 2022 sunucu üzerinde sıfırdan Hyper-V kurulumu için gerekli tüm adımları, ön gereksinimleri, BIOS/UEFI ayarlarını, rol kurulumunu ve sonrası yapılandırmayı ayrıntılı olarak bulabilirsiniz.

Hyper-V Nedir? Neden Windows Server 2022 Üzerinde Kullanmalısınız?

Hyper-V, Microsoft’un Type-1 (bare-metal) mimaride çalışan kurumsal hiper yönetici platformudur. Windows Server 2022 üzerinde Hyper-V kullanmanın avantajları:

  • Gelişmiş güvenlik (Secure Boot, VBS, TPM Passthrough)
  • Daha hızlı sanal makine performansı
  • Modern donanım desteği (Gen2 VM’ler, UEFI)
  • Yazılım tanımlı depolama/switch entegrasyonları
  • Live Migration, Replica ve Failover Cluster entegrasyonu
  • Kurumsal Workload’lar için optimize edilmiş kaynak yönetimi

Hyper-V Kurulumu İçin Gereksinimler

Hyper-V kurulumu öncesinde hem BIOS/UEFI hem de işletim sistemi gereksinimlerinin karşılanması gerekir.

Donanım Gereksinimleri

  • Donanım sanallaştırma: Intel VT-x veya AMD-V
  • Second Level Address Translation (SLAT)
  • Data Execution Prevention (DEP)
  • Minimum 8 GB (tavsiye: 16–32 GB ve üzeri)
  • SSD veya NVMe yüksek IOPS disk yapısı
  • Ayrı bir disk veya RAID yapılandırması önerilir

BIOS/UEFI Ayarları

Sunucuyu yeniden başlatın ve BIOS/UEFI menüsünde aşağıdaki ayarların açık olduğundan emin olun:

  • Intel Virtualization Technology (VT-x) → Enabled
  • Intel VT-d / AMD-Vi (I/O MMU) → Enabled
  • Data Execution Prevention / NX → Enabled
  • TPM 2.0 (Gen2 VM’ler için önerilir)

Windows Server 2022 Üzerine Hyper-V Kurulumu (GUI)

Aşağıdaki adımlar, Server Manager üzerinden Hyper-V rolünün kurulmasını kapsar.

Server Manager’ı Açın

  • Start > Server Manager

“Add Roles and Features” Menü Seçimi

  • Manage > Add Roles and Features
  • Role-Based or Feature-Based Installation seçilir.

Sunucunun Seçilmesi

Fiziksel sunucunuzu listeden seçin.

Hyper-V Rolünü İşaretleyin

Rol listesinden:

  • Hyper-V
  • İstenirse: Hyper-V Management Tools

Kurulum sırasında sizden Virtual Switch yapılandırması istenebilir. Dilerseniz kurulumdan sonra da yapılandırabilirsiniz.

Kurulumu Başlatın ve Sunucuyu Yeniden Başlatın

  • Install
  • Kurulum tamamlandığında Restart Now

PowerShell ile Hyper-V Kurulumu (Tavsiye Edilen)

Sistem yöneticilerinin büyük bölümü daha kontrollü bir kurulum istediği için PowerShell tercih eder.

Hyper-V rolünü PowerShell ile kurmak için:

Install-WindowsFeature -Name Hyper-V -IncludeManagementTools -Restart

Kurulum sonrası doğrulama:

Get-WindowsFeature -Name Hyper-V

Hyper-V Sanal Switch (vSwitch) Oluşturma

Hyper-V kurulduktan sonra sanal makinelerin iletişimi için bir Virtual Switch tanımlanmalıdır.

PowerShell ile vSwitch Oluşturma

New-VMSwitch -Name “Prod-vSwitch” -NetAdapterName “Ethernet0” -AllowManagementOS $true -SwitchType External

Parametre açıklamaları:

  • SwitchType External → Fiziksel NIC üzerinden dış dünya ile iletişim.
  • AllowManagementOS → Hyper-V host’unun aynı NIC’i kullanmasını sağlar.

Yeni Sanal Makine Oluşturma (Örnek)

Hyper-V başarılı şekilde kurulduktan sonra temel bir VM oluşturma örneği:

New-VM -Name “WS2022-VM01” -MemoryStartupBytes 4GB -Generation 2 -NewVHDPath “D:\VMs\WS2022-VM01.vhdx” -NewVHDSizeBytes 80GB -SwitchName “Prod-vSwitch”

VM’i başlatma:

Start-VM -Name “WS2022-VM01”

Hyper-V Host Üzerinde Yapılması Tavsiye Edilen Ek Yapılandırmalar

Failover Cluster Desteği (Opsiyonel)

Windows Server 2022 hızlı cluster geçişi ve Storage Spaces Direct gibi çözümleri doğal olarak destekler.

Live Migration’ın Etkinleştirilmesi

Enable-VMMigration

Set-VMMigrationNetwork -IPAddress ‘10.10.10.0/24’

Default VM Locations Düzenleme

Varsayılan konumları değiştirmek için:

  • Hyper-V Manager > Hyper-V Settings
  • Virtual Hard Disks
  • Virtual Machines

Kurumsal ortamlarda SSD/NVMe dizilerinde ayrı datastore kullanımı önerilir.

Hyper-V Kurulumunda Yaygın Hatalar ve Çözümleri

Hata Açıklama Çözüm
Hyper-V Cannot Be Installed BIOS sanallaştırma kapalı VT-x/AMD-V aktif edin
Virtual Switch Oluşturulamıyor Ethernet Teaming veya VLAN yapılandırması çakışıyor NIC Teaming’i doğrulayın
Gen2 VM Boot Edemiyor Secure Boot yanlış yapılandırılmış Secure Boot Template → Microsoft Windows seçilmeli
Host Performans Düşüklüğü RAM oversubscription Dynamic Memory veya rezervasyon ayarlayın

Hyper-V, Windows Server 2022 üzerinde güçlü, ölçeklenebilir ve güvenli bir sanallaştırma platformu sunar. Fiziksel bir sunucuda Hyper-V kurulumu, doğru BIOS ayarlarının yapılması, rolün GUI veya PowerShell ile yüklenmesi ve sonrasında sanal switch ile VM yapılandırmalarının yapılmasıyla hızlı şekilde hayata geçirilebilir.


 

1988 İstanbul doğumluyum. Bilgisayar dünyasına olan hayranlığım çok küçük yaşlarda başladı. Bu sebeple sistem alanında kendimi geliştirmeye karar verdim. Celal Bayar Üniversitesi Bilgisayar Programcılığı ve Anadolu Üniversitesi İşletme mezunuyum. Beykent Üniversitesi'nde Yönetim Bilişim Sistemleri Bölümü'nde yüksek lisans eğitimimi tamamladım. 2005 yılında Bilge Adam Sistem & Network Mühendisliği eğitimi aldım. Hemen ardından IT dünyasına giriş yaptım. Collezione şirketinde 2006 - 2018 yılları arasında Sistem Uzmanı olarak görev yaptım. 2018 Temmuz ayından beri LCWAIKIKI şirketinde System Engineer pozisyonunda çalışmaktayım. Sektörde 19 yıllık deneyime sahibim. Birçok önemli projede görev aldım. Sayfanın en alt kısmından Linkedin profilime ulaşabilirsiniz. Bilgi ve tecrübemi hem bu blog üzerinde hem de Çözümpark Bilişim Portalı üzerinde paylaşıyorum.

Yorum gönder